General Specifications
- Maximum single sheet size is 50 x 500
inches.
- Multi-panel photo murals or mosaics
allow larger sizes.
- Continuous tone imaging produces
apparent resolution above 3600 dpi.
- Color, Monochrome, or Infrared Images
at same cost.
- Ideal input resolution is 200dpi, but
many applications allow less.
- True Photographs are Still Superior to
Inkjet Technology:
- Moisture Safe
- Wipeable, Smudge-proof
- Stain Resistant
- Images are safe for generations.
- “Permanent” markers may be used, then
erased with alcohol on a soft cloth for planning purposes.
Acceptable file formats include: .tif,
.sid, .jpg, .pdf, mxd, .dwg, .dgn, .ps, .eps, .psd, and
more.
